Lasik Procedure
LASIK is simply an acronym which stands for Laser-Assisted In Situ Keratomileusis, meaning “shaping the cornea by means of a laser”. Before LASIK technology was introduced into the world of vision correction, the only way eye doctors were able to correct vision was through standard prescription glasses or contact lenses. However, with today’s modern advances in laser technology our Denver LASIK surgeon are able to map and a measure each unique imperfection in a person’s cornea and correct them through Denver Laser eye surgery. LASIK has proven successful in treating those living with nearsightedness, farsightedness, and astigmatism.
